当前位置: 首页 > news >正文

郑州网站建设乛汉狮网络php响应式网站模板

郑州网站建设乛汉狮网络,php响应式网站模板,镇江网站建设方式优化,网络营销第2版课后答案基于业务做选择,强一致性和允许延迟再加消息队列 强一致性:当修改了数据库的数据同时更新缓存的数据,缓存和数据库的数据保持一致 读操作:缓存命中,直接返回数据,缓存没有命中,查询数据库,写入缓存,设定过期时间 写操作:延迟双删 :先删除缓存,修改数据库,等待延迟(数据库主从节… 基于业务做选择,强一致性和允许延迟再加消息队列 强一致性:当修改了数据库的数据同时更新缓存的数据,缓存和数据库的数据保持一致 读操作:缓存命中,直接返回数据,缓存没有命中,查询数据库,写入缓存,设定过期时间 写操作:延迟双删 :先删除缓存,修改数据库,等待延迟(数据库主从节点,读写分离,需要等待主节点数据传给从节点的数据库,从节点负责被其他线程读取,只有从节点的数据正确的时候再被读取才能够保证新的缓存是正确的),再删除缓存,等其他线程读取从节点数据写新的缓存数据到缓存中,但是延迟时间不好掌握,时间短了依然会有脏数据,时间长了性能太差 解决办法: 分布式锁: 线程1:先加锁,写入数据,删除缓存,释放锁 线程2:等待锁,加锁,读缓存未命中,读取数据库,更新缓存,解锁 读写锁:redission提供的读写锁 共享锁:读锁readlock,加锁之后,其他线程可以共享读操作 排他锁:独占锁writeLock,加锁之后,阻塞其他线程的读写操作 当线程是读操作时加共享锁,其他线程依然可以读取数据 当线程是写操作时加排他锁,其他线程被阻塞,这样可以极大提升分布式锁的性能 优点:强一致 缺点:性能低 允许延迟一致:采用异步通知 最终一致性:可以使用MQ的可靠性来保证数据的最终一致性,修改数据发送消息给MQ,监听消息来更新缓存.
http://www.dnsts.com.cn/news/143531.html

相关文章:

  • 江苏固茗建设有限公司网站免费的建手机网站
  • 怎么用网站视频做自媒体插件wordpress
  • 网站外链做网站用盗版PS
  • 外贸网站推广运营网站空间商那个好
  • wordpress建售卖产品的网站天猫网站左侧菜单向右滑出的导航菜单
  • 合肥网络公司 网站建设栾城哪家公司做网站
  • 网站都是用什么语言写的广告seo是什么意思
  • 买链接做网站 利润高吗做装修那个网站好
  • php网站案例网站开发(七)数据库的建表与连接
  • 浙江创新网站建设销售网站使用的主色调
  • 找人做网站需要注意问题wordpress v2ex
  • 常州 网站制作建什么类型的网站访问量比较大
  • 网站机房建设流程北京网站推广排名
  • 企业网站推广内容网站建设推广人员
  • 网站需要哪些手续python做的网站有哪些
  • 网站建设脚本深圳市龙岗区住房和建设局官网网站
  • 网站首页权重seo关键词排名优化报价
  • cdn网站加速原理广州网站建设案例
  • 网站设计制作有哪些原因微信支付 wordpress
  • 电商网站要素物联网平台开源
  • 西安单位网站建设厦门seo网站建设费用
  • 做网站的集团设计网站最重要的是要有良好的
  • 织梦网站转移wordpress 修改邮箱
  • 金华网站建设团队工作室起名大全
  • 买网站多少钱百度 wordpress插件
  • 电商网站建设考试题海洋做网站
  • 沧县网站建设公司免费的网页设计成品详解
  • 区块链网站开发资金有谁用2008做网站服务器
  • 网站建设的上市公司网站建设排名优化
  • 洛阳做网站价格广州网站建设易企